WWE announced that Februray’s PPV will be called Fast Lane in 2015, ending a multiple year run of the Elimination Chamber running in February.

In 2013, WWE presented a CM Punk vs. The Rock rematch alongside an Elimination Chamber match, but it was conisdered a disappointing buyrate. Then in 2014, the newly unified WWE World Heavyweight Championship was decided in the Chamber, again to disappointing business results.

With only one WWE World Heavyweight Championship, WWE no longer has a need for a second major setup PPV for Wrestlemania each year.

Instead, WWE plans on a more focused building between Royal Rumble and Wrestlemania, without the Elimination Chamber in between to cause confusion. It’s largely expected that the Elimination Chamber will be moved later in the year, perhaps to July as a setup for Summerslam later in the summer.
